INTEROH GALE MURAL

‘INTEROH GALE’ MURAL BY MEDIAH HAS TRANSFORMED THE UNDERPASS AT FINCH AVE AND MORNINGSIDE, SCARBOROUGH, SUMMER 2019 The mural INTEROH GALE by artist MEDIAH in partnership with Mural Routes in Malvern, North Scarborough is themed around sustainability and has provided local youth and emerging artists mentorship and training opportunities.   ABOUT THE MURAL CONCEPT AND …

Birch Cliff Murals 2013 Media Release

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E Mural Routes unveils three new Birch Cliff murals, including the monumental Forest of Birch Trees mural at Birch Cliff Public School November 25, 2013 This past summer, not-for-profit mural arts service organization Mural Routes created three new murals in Toronto’s Birch Cliff community, as part of the Birch Cliff Community Mural Project. …
